South Gwinnett was not able to break out of their rough patch on Wednesday as the team picked up their 11th straight defeat. They came up short against the Heritage Patriots, falling 17-6. Unfortunately, that's the second time they've come up short against the Patriots this season, as they also lost their prior matchup 18-2 last Monday.
Christopher Frazier was cooking despite his team's loss, scoring a run while going 2-for-3. Giovanni Austin also deserves some recognition as he got his first hit of the season.
South Gwinnett's loss dropped their record down to 1-12. As for Heritage, the win was the fourth in a row for them, bringing their record for this year to 10-5.
While South Gwinnett had to take the loss, they won't have to wait long to give it another shot: the pair's next game is a rematch scheduled at 5:55 p.m. on Friday.
